description | FUNCTION: Automated description from the Alliance of Genome Resources (Release 8.0.0) Predicted to enable lipopolysaccharide binding activity. Predicted to be involved in several processes, including defense response to other organism; lipopolysaccharide-mediated signaling pathway; and negative regulation of cytokine production. Located in cytoplasm.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in Crohn's disease. Orthologous to human BPI (bactericidal permeability increasing protein). PHENOTYPE: Mice homozygous for a null allele display increased susceptibility to induced colitis and impaired IL22 induction. [provided by MGI curators] |
